资讯处理链架构编程:编译策略与性能优化解析

资讯处理链架构编程是一种将数据从输入到输出的流程进行系统化设计的方法,其核心在于如何高效地编译和优化代码。编译策略在这一过程中起着关键作用,决定了程序的执行效率和资源利用率。

AI生成结论图,仅供参考

编译器在处理资讯处理链时,需要识别并优化数据流路径。例如,通过静态分析确定哪些操作可以提前执行或合并,从而减少冗余计算。这种优化手段能够显著提升整体性能。

性能优化不仅依赖于编译策略,还需要结合运行时环境进行调整。例如,动态调度和内存管理技术可以在不同硬件平台上实现更优的执行效果。合理的内存布局和缓存利用也是提升性能的重要因素。

在实际应用中,开发者应关注代码结构的清晰性与可扩展性。良好的模块划分有助于编译器进行更有效的优化,同时也能降低维护成本。•使用高效的算法和数据结构是提升整体性能的基础。

随着硬件技术的发展,编译策略也在不断演进。现代编译器支持多核、向量化的指令集,使得资讯处理链能够在更复杂的环境中发挥更大效能。掌握这些技术,有助于构建高性能的应用系统。

dawei

【声明】:蚌埠站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。